Top 15 Remote Jobs with Competitive Salaries (and Companies Currently Recruiting)

The job market has undergone significant changes in recent years, with more people opting for remote work opportunities. This shift has allowed individuals to explore high-paying remote jobs that offer flexibility and comfort while working from home. Whether you are considering a career change or looking to boost your income, there are various remote job options worth exploring.

1. Data Scientist:
Data scientists play a crucial role in helping organizations understand patterns in data by collecting and analyzing information from various sources. With an average salary of $153,137, this role offers significant growth opportunities, with a projected 36% increase in career outlook through 2031.

2. Cloud Architect:
Cloud architects design computing systems that connect web servers for data storage and other IT functions. With an average salary of $144,432, this role is expected to grow at a rate of 9% until 2031, offering opportunities for career advancement.

3. Telemedicine Nurse Practitioner:
Remote nurse practitioners provide medical consultations and treatment for patients through online health services. With an average salary of $131,543, this role offers stability in the healthcare industry, with a projected 6% growth in career outlook.

4. Developer:
Remote developers design and create software and applications for their employers or clients. With an average salary of $125,932, this role is expected to grow by 23% through 2031, providing ample opportunities for career progression.

5. Product Designer (Senior):
Senior product designers lead teams of designers to brainstorm new products across various industries. With an average salary of $122,026, this role is projected to experience a 23% growth in career outlook until 2031.

6. User Experience Researcher:
UX researchers analyze customer behavior and needs to improve products and services. With an average salary of $119,911, this role offers a 15% growth in career opportunities over the next few years.

7. Cyber Security Analyst:
Cyber security analysts monitor network systems for threats and attacks to protect data. With an average salary of $109,728, this role is expected to grow by 35% until 2031, making it a high-demand career option.

8. Technical Writer:
Technical writers create documents explaining complex technical information in simple terms. With an average salary of $78,388, this role offers stable growth opportunities, with a projected 6% increase in job opportunities until 2031.

9. Inside Sales Manager:
Inside sales managers oversee the sales division of a company, meeting sales goals and staying updated on technology and leadership skills. With an average salary of $72,212, this role offers a 5% growth in career outlook through 2031.

10. Social Media Marketing Manager:
Social media managers oversee advertising and campaigns on social media platforms. With an average salary of $65,997, this role is projected to grow by 10% over the next few years, offering opportunities for career advancement.

11. Corporate Recruiter:
Corporate recruiters support companies by finding, interviewing, and hiring new staff. With an average salary of $65,950, this role is expected to see an 8% growth in career opportunities through 2031.

12. Grant Writer:
Grant writers research and apply for funding opportunities to support organizations. With an average salary of $65,478, this role is projected to grow by 4% until 2031, providing stable job opportunities.

13. Business Development Representative:
Business development professionals help marketing and sales teams find new sales opportunities and expand product offerings. With an average salary of $59,025, this role is expected to see an 8% growth in career opportunities through 2031.

14. Video Editor:
Video editors use software to edit and optimize video content. With an average salary of $58,972, this role is projected to grow by 12% through 2031, offering opportunities for career advancement.

15. Remote Inpatient Coder:
Inpatient coders enter codes for medical diagnoses and procedures into software for billing. With an average salary of $51,203, this role is expected to grow by 7% until 2031, providing stable job opportunities in the healthcare industry.
